Formatting and Design Tips



Producing a visually appealing funeral service program is important for communicating regard and recognizing the deceased.

Start with a tidy layout that guides the reader's eye. Make use of a readable typeface, adhering to a couple of styles to maintain uniformity. Pick a color design that reflects the individuality of the deceased-- soft pastels for a gentle tone or deeper colors for an extra sad feel.

Integrate purposeful pictures or icons that represent their life. Maintain message organized with clear headings and sufficient spacing between sections to enhance readability. Don't overcrowd the program; much less is commonly much more.

Ultimately, take into consideration including a personal touch, like a favored quote or poem, to make it really special and unforgettable.

Dos and Do n'ts of Funeral Program Etiquette



Browsing funeral program rules can feel frustrating, yet complying with a couple of easy dos and do n'ts can aid guarantee you honor the departed properly.



Do include the complete name, dates, and a picture of the deceased. Share individual tales or quotes that mirror their personality. Maintain the tone respectful and helpful.

Don't overload the program with excessive text. Avoid using informal language or humor, as it might come off as ill-mannered. Avoid reviewing debatable topics or personal complaints, as this isn't the moment or location.
